O. Box 758 Greeley, CO 80632 Dear Commissioners: Enclosed please find a copy of Resolution No. TC-301 as adopted by the Transportation Commission of Colorado on September 23, 1994. This resolution abandons approximately 1.25 miles of SH 34 east of Kersey. The appropriate steps will be taken to update both the IRIS database and the Weld County Road Inventory. WHEREAS, State Highway 34 (SH 34) is part of the State TC-301 Highway System; and WHEREAS, the Colorado Department of Transportation (CDOT) is responsible under §43-2-102, C.R.S. , to maintain SH 34, and the Transportation Commission is responsible under §43-1-106, C.R.S. , to formulate the general policy with respect to such maintenance; and WHEREAS, the Transportation Commission also has the authority under S43-2-106, C.R. S . , to abandon a portion of SH 34 if such portion is no longer needed as a State Highway; and WHEREAS, an Environmental Assessment and Finding of No Significant Impacts was processed and written for Project CX-CY 03-0034-19; and WHEREAS, these documents identified the need to increase highway capacity and enhance the design safety elements along that segment of SH 34; and WHEREAS, the location and design alternatives were analyzed that included a four lane roadway design, coupled with a new alignment of SH 34 Corridor; and WHEREAS, the environmental impacts were evaluated for each alternative; and WHEREAS, Exhibit A (as contained in the official agenda) describes the selected alternative between Kersey and Hardin; and WHEREAS, the Environmental Assessment was signed by the CDOT and FHWA on August 12, 1993; and WHEREAS, the Finding of No Significant Impacts was signed by CDOT and concurred by the FHWA on August 12, 1993; and WHEREAS, under §43--106, and due to the new alignment of SH 34, any portion of SH 34 abandoned by the Commission will then become a county road if the portion is still necessary for use as a public highway and if the Board of County Commissioners of the County where that portion exists adopts a resolution to the effect; and WHEREAS, by the Resolution dated September 19, 1994, Exhibit B (as contained in the official agenda) the Board of County Commissioners of Weld County has the intention to accept that portion of current State Highway 34 described in Exhibit A as part of the Weld County road system upon Transportation Commission abandonment; and 941262 WHEREAS, as a result of Weld County accepting the portion of State Highway 34 onto its County roadway system, that portion will remain a public road and, therefore, no landowner will suffer damages due to this action. N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, that the Transportation Commission of Colorado: Abandons SH 34 from a point of intersection with the new SH 34, east of Kersey (see construction project STA 034-019) and continuing east or approximately 1 .25 miles.
